23 changes: 23 additions & 0 deletions tests/providers/ssh/hooks/test_ssh.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-1092,3 +1092,26 @@ def test_connection_failure(self):
status, msg = hook.test_connection()
assert status is False
assert msg == "Test failure case"

def test_ssh_connection_client_is_reused_if_open(self):
hook = SSHHook(ssh_conn_id="ssh_default")
client1 = hook.get_conn()
client2 = hook.get_conn()
assert client1 is client2
assert client2.get_transport().is_active()

def test_ssh_connection_client_is_recreated_if_closed(self):
hook = SSHHook(ssh_conn_id="ssh_default")
client1 = hook.get_conn()
client1.close()
client2 = hook.get_conn()
assert client1 is not client2
assert client2.get_transport().is_active()

def test_ssh_connection_client_is_recreated_if_transport_closed(self):
hook = SSHHook(ssh_conn_id="ssh_default")
client1 = hook.get_conn()
client1.get_transport().close()
client2 = hook.get_conn()
assert client1 is not client2
assert client2.get_transport().is_active()
